Moldanga

Moldanga is a village located in Garbeta Ii subdivision of Paschim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 28.5km away from sub-district headquarter Garbeta . Midnapur is the district headquarter of Moldanga village. As per 2009 stats, Gohaldanga is the gram panchayat of Moldanga village.

About Moldanga

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Moldanga is 336725. The village spans a total geographical area of 80.38 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721157. Garhbeta is nearest town to Moldanga village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 28km away.

When it comes to local governance, Moldanga village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Salboni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Jhargram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Moldanga

According to the 2011 Census, Moldanga has a total population of about 185, with approximately 93 males and 92 females. The sex ratio is around 989 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 24 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 185. The overall literacy rate is approximately 58.92%, with male literacy at about 75.27% and female literacy near 42.39%. There are around 45 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Moldanga's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 185 93 92
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 24 7 17
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 185 93 92
Literate Population 109 70 39
Illiterate Population 76 23 53

Connectivity of Moldanga

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Moldanga. As per the 2011 stats, Moldanga had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
